And BTW, the epoxy putty was in addition to hammering in several wood shims. I didn't feel like I could get sufficient stiffness in the joint from just the shims, so I added the epoxy putty. Agree that alone it would be insufficient. I have both epoxy putty and milliput on hand all the time now -- epoxy putty is weaker but does harden faster. Milliput has more strength but takes several hours to harden. Both can be sanded and easily ground down with the ever-handy dremel tool.
